Here at Serenity Acres we specialize in boarding services (12x12 matted stalls) offering an indoor arena (60x90), small trails that lead out to a back dirt road, outdoor riding area (in progress), corral, etc. We also offer on-site leases, beginner lessons, established with an equine body worker that provides wellness services to our boarders on a routine basis. 🐴 Lessons Are an Investment in Character 🐴

Horseback riding is often viewed as a hobby, a sport, or even a competition. And yes, anything with the word “equine” attached to it can be expensive.

But riding lessons are so much more than an investment in a sport—they are an investment in character.

Horses teach responsibility, patience, discipline, perseverance, and humility. They teach us how to work through frustration, celebrate success with grace, and learn from disappointment. They teach us that progress doesn’t happen overnight and that sometimes the greatest growth comes from the rides that don’t go as planned.

There will be wins, there will be losses, and there will be moments when you want to quit. Yet horses have a way of teaching us to get back on, try again, and keep moving forward.

Whether it’s a child’s first lead-line lesson or an adult pursuing a lifelong passion, the lessons learned around horses extend far beyond the arena. They build confidence, work ethic, problem-solving skills, and the ability to connect with and understand another living being.

The ribbons eventually get packed away. The trophies collect dust.

But the character, resilience, and life lessons horses teach remain long after the ride is over.

That’s the true value of riding lessons. ❤️

🌟 Instructor Spotlight: Cassie 🌟

Cassie has been involved with horses her entire life, beginning her journey in 4-H and continuing to compete through the years in a variety of disciplines. Alongside her horse, Thunder—the heart and soul of our lesson program—she has done it all, from jumping, trail riding, gaming classes, showmanship and Western events to English disciplines and dressage. Together, they have competed successfully at local shows and prestigious Class A Morgan shows, earning numerous championships, awards, and Horse of the Year honors. Thunder was even featured in the Morgan Horse magazine!

Cassie is passionate about helping riders of all ages and experience levels grow their confidence and skills. Whether working with a first-time rider or helping a more advanced student reach the next level, her lessons are fun, interactive, and focused on developing well-rounded horsemen and horsewomen. From grooming and horse care to riding and horsemanship, Cassie believes in teaching students from the ground up.

Her patience, knowledge, and enthusiasm make her a favorite among our riders, and we are so grateful to have her as part of our program! 🐴❤️

What do kids learn in our lesson program?

A lot more than just riding a horse.

Our students learn how to groom, lead, tack up, carry equipment, care for their horse, and understand the responsibilities that come with being around these amazing animals. Riding is only one piece of the puzzle.

By learning horsemanship both in and out of the saddle, our students develop confidence, responsibility, patience, and respect—skills that extend far beyond the barn.

We’re proud to help create well-rounded horsemen and horsewomen, one lesson at a time. ❤️🐴
